H. B. 2480


(By Delegate Sobonya)

[Introduced February 17, 2005 ; referred to the

Committee on the Judiciary.]





A BILL to amend the code of West Virginia, 1931, as amended, by adding thereto a new section, designated §29-25-23a, relating to prohibiting account wagering and electronic betting.

Be it enacted by the Legislature of West Virginia:

That the code of West Virginia, 1931, as amended, be amended by adding thereto a new section, designated §29-25-23a, to read as follows:

ARTICLE 25. AUTHORIZED GAMING FACILITY.

§29-25-23a. Prohibition on account wagering and electronic betting.

(a) For the purposes of this section:
(1) "Account wagering" means the act of making a wager from a financial account exclusively opened and designed for the purpose of providing funds, or a line of credit, to be used to gamble on any type of game of chance.
(2) "Electronic betting" means the act of placing a bet on any game of chance, through any electronic means, including, but not limited to, internet, telephone or cable transmission.
(b) A gaming licensee, including any race track or other gaming center or establishment, may not provide or maintain any service or device which, in effect, constitutes a financial account or line of credit to be used for the purpose of account wagering. Nor may a gaming licensee, including any race track or other gaming center or establishment, provide, maintain or possess any service or equipment intended for use, in whole or in part, for electronic betting.



NOTE: The purpose of this bill is to prohibit account wagering and electronic betting.

This section is new; therefore, strike-throughs and underscoring have been omitted.
